Arsenal Target Emmanuel Dennis Set To Leave Club Brugge

By Daily Sports on May 19, 2020

Arsenal target Emmanuel Dennis looks set to leave Club Brugge before the start of the 2020/21 season.

According to the Daily Mail, the Nigeria international will part ways with the Belgium Pro League club.

Brugge head coach Philippe Clement has conceded that the 22-year-old will leave the club with Arsenal, Borussia Dortmund, Newcastle United, Brighton & Hove Albion, Sheffield United, Watford, Monaco and Sampdoria all having been linked with his services.

“It is very likely that Dennis will leave,” Clement told La Derniere Heure via the Daily Mail. “He can also count on a lot of interest. It is the time for him to take a new step.”

Dennis, who is contracted to Brugge until 2022, joined the Belgian giants from Ukrainian club side Zorya Luhansk three years ago.

Dennis scored nine goals in 33 appearances for the Belgium Pro League champions across all competitions this season, including two in the club’s 2-2 draw away to Real Madrid in the UEFA Champions League group stages.
